WEST ELEMENTARY SCHOOL
West Elem is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the Valley Center Pub Sch school district, located in Valley Center, KS with about 409 students offering grade levels from Kindergarten to 4th Grade.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 23 teachers, West Elem has a student/teacher ratio of about 17: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

School Demographics for 409 students
The primary ethnicity of students attending WEST 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is predominantly White, representing about 79% of the student body.
- White
- 79.0%
- Hispanic/Latino
- 13.2%
- Two or more races
- 5.4%
- Black or African American
- 1.2%
- Asian
- 0.5%
- American Indian or Alaska Native
- 0.5%
- Native Hawaiian or Other Pacific Islander
- 0.2%
- Female
- 47.2%
- Male
- 52.8%
